Years ago Ariel went to the bank to get a loan to start a bakery. However, the man she met with, Lancelot, accused her of being a fraud and denied her application. Fast forward to the present and Ariel gets a new hot neighbor who is none other than Lancelot. Now that they are neighbors can they get over the past and move forward in a civil manner?
Ariel grew up in a very strict community and was to meet the man she was supposed to marry when she was 14 years old. Her brothers helped her escape but that left her living on the streets and taking every little job that she could in order to try and make her brothers proud even though she will never see them again.
Lancelot lost his father and had to take over as the caregiver for his siblings. This has caused him to become arrogant and full of himself.
Overall I found this book to be enjoyable. At first I was confused about the relevance of the emails at the end of the chapters but by chapter 7 you started to get a glimpse of how they fit into the story. Reading about Ariel’s background and everything she went through really touched my heart and I’m glad that she got her HEA.
